Output 3f49320755ce1a64cd21e0d2f70d9c73c715e9c50b36a4a61e7a8787628f9561:8

value
2391766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2905a57644e24e0ec995db6522603a73d04de2d OP_EQUAL
address
3PoaNnJ75zpfW1FNRiEjzTsKwah6ikt9WA
transaction
3f49320755ce1a64cd21e0d2f70d9c73c715e9c50b36a4a61e7a8787628f9561
confirmations
271755
spent
true